Assembled safety protective guard
Technical Field
The utility model belongs to the technical field of safety protective guards, and particularly relates to an assembled safety protective guard.
Background
The protective guard is mainly used as a partition when accident treatment is carried out, and can be widely used in places such as traffic safety, urban roads, engineering construction, accident sites and the like, and on a building construction site, in order to prevent safety accidents, the protective guard is usually arranged around the construction site, and the protective guard has a mounting structure that a protective net is mounted between upright posts which are erected and fixed.
Most of the existing guard railings are simple in structure and poor in stability in the using process.

In the first embodiment, as shown in fig. 1 to 4, the protective mesh comprises a protective mesh 1, wherein two sides of the protective mesh 1 are symmetrically and movably provided with upright columns 2, one side of the top of each upright column 2 is hinged with an inclined rod 3, the bottom end of each inclined rod 3 is provided with an installation seat 4, the bottom of each inclined rod 3 is connected with the bottom of each upright column 2 through a reinforcing component 5, each reinforcing component 5 comprises a first threaded rod 16 hinged to one side of the bottom of each upright column 2, an adjusting frame 17 is arranged on each first threaded rod 16 in a threaded manner, one end of each adjusting frame 17 is provided with a second threaded rod 18 in a threaded manner, the threaded direction of each first threaded rod 16 is opposite to that of each second threaded rod 18, one end of each second threaded rod 18 is rotatably provided with a hook 19, and one side of the bottom of each inclined rod 3 is provided with a hook 20 corresponding to the bottom.
Second embodiment, on the basis of the first embodiment, the protection mesh sheet 1 includes a supporting frame 6, a supporting rod 7 is installed on the inner wall of the middle portion of the supporting frame 6, mesh bars 8 which are arranged vertically and horizontally are symmetrically installed on both sides of the supporting rod 7, connecting pieces 9 are symmetrically installed on both sides of the supporting frame 6, connecting seats 10 corresponding to the supporting rod are installed on the upright posts 2, a connecting groove 11 is formed in the middle portion of the connecting seat 10, the connecting piece 9 is connected with the connecting seat 10 through a first bolt 12, first mounting holes corresponding to the first bolt 12 are formed in both the connecting piece 9 and the connecting seat 10, a supporting plate 13 is installed below the supporting frame 6, a fixing seat 14 is installed on one side of the supporting plate 13, the fixing seat 14 and the supporting plate 13 are connected with the outer wall of the upright post 2, the supporting plate 13 is abutted against the supporting frame 6, the fixing seat 14 is connected with the supporting frame 6 through a second bolt 15, second mounting holes corresponding to the second bolts 15 are formed in the fixed seat 14 and the supporting frame 6;
install fixing base 14 on subaerial through the gim peg, then according to actual need side direction rotation down tube 3 for mount pad 4 deflects to suitable position, then install mount pad 4 on subaerial through the gim peg, insert the connection piece 9 on the protection net piece 1 in spread groove 11, then be connected connection piece 9 and connecting seat 10 through first bolt 12, then through second bolt 15 with protection net piece 1 be connected with fixing base 14 can, realize the installation to protection net piece 1 promptly.
The working principle is as follows: when the protective net piece 1 is in operation, when a user needs to install the protective net piece 1, the fixing seat 14 is installed on the ground only through the fixing bolt, the inclined rod 3 is laterally rotated according to actual needs, the installation seat 4 is deflected to a proper position, the installation seat 4 is installed on the ground through the fixing bolt, the adjusting frame 17 is rotated, at the moment, the hook 19 is laterally moved due to the fact that the direction of the thread on the first threaded rod 16 is opposite to the direction of the thread on the second threaded rod 18, when the hook 19 moves to a certain length, the hook 19 is hung on the hook ring 20, then the adjusting frame 17 is continuously rotated, the hook 19 is tightly clamped on the hook ring 20, namely, clamping between the upright post 2 and the inclined rod 3 is achieved, namely, the protective net piece 1 is further protected, then the protective net piece 9 on the protective net piece 1 is inserted into the connecting groove 11, and then the connecting piece 9 is connected with the connecting seat 10 through the first bolt 12, then, the protection net sheet 1 is connected with the fixed seat 14 through the second bolt 15, and the protection net sheet 1 is installed.
